
🎬 Title: Tehran / तेहरान
Chased by Iran. Forsaken by Israel. Left behind by India.
Plot Summary: On February 13, 2012, a powerful bomb detonated, targeting an Israeli embassy car in Delhi. Leading the investigation, ACP Rajeev Kumar suspects there’s more beneath the surface. With increasing political pressure and hints of an Iranian link, he embarks on a dangerous quest for truth, contending with fierce opposition along the way.
